Ticket-pricing experiment (Lanternfare, cohort B). If conversion drops >3% against control, kill the flag `dynamic_fare_v2` via the Ombra console — no deploy needed. Check the pricing dashboard hourly during the first 48h. Do not adjust floor prices mid-experiment; it contaminates the cohort. Escalate anomalies to the revenue pod lead. The experiment config snapshot we validated against is pinned below.

pipeline stamp: htk9_6ce9d33c5

### Key Ceremony Checklist — Item 7: EXIF Scrubbing Verification

Before any ceremony photos are archived to the Lanternfall evidence store, confirm the Scrubmill pipeline has stripped all EXIF metadata: GPS coordinates, device serials, timestamps, and thumbnail caches. The reviewer must inspect three random samples with the hex inspector, not just the summary report. Once verification is signed off, the sealed archive can only be reopened with the recovery passphrase recorded directly below this item.

vault phrase of bagaf-kajeg = jorath-feniel-briir-siliel-ralix

FINANCE REVIEW SUMMARY — Board

Subject: Calderwyn Foods expansion into the Vastermark region.

Entry costs tracking 4% under budget. Distribution agreement with Norrgate Supply executed. Payback modelled at 30 months; sensitivity runs hold under downside volume assumptions. Staffing plan approved; regulatory filings on schedule. No change to capital request. Recommendation: proceed as planned. The strategic note below is for board eyes only.

board note of hawif-kadug: Holethek Partners is in early talks to buy Rusokek Foods for about $62.0 million. The Quenius launch date is June 15, and nothing goes to the press before then.

## v4.2.0 — Changed defaults

The Klaxonmere alert deduplicator now groups alerts by fingerprint across a five-minute sliding window instead of the old fixed sixty-second bucket. Plugin authors should note that suppression callbacks may now fire later than before, and duplicate counts reported to downstream hooks will generally be higher. If your plugin relied on the old bucket boundaries, pin the legacy behavior via the compatibility flag. The new defaults shipping with this release are as follows:

config for hahaf-kafof:
[wenys]
host = wenys.torvahq.corp
user = wenys_svc
database = wenys_prod